Hysteroscopy is a minimally invasive technique that allows direct examination of the inside of the uterus. It is used to diagnose and, in some cases, treat conditions such as polyps, endometrial abnormalities, and causes of unexplained bleeding. Using a thin instrument, the gynecologist is able to provide an accurate diagnosis, improving treatment options for each woman.
